برنامه نویسی

[Flatiron SE] روز 1: 08/27/24

Summarize this content to 400 words in Persian Lang سلام، فیش اینجاست،

این اولین پست وبلاگ من خواهد بود! من این کار را به درخواست مربی شگفت انگیزم در مدرسه Flatiron انجام می دهم. من سعی خواهم کرد هر روز یک پست وبلاگ ایجاد کنم که توسعه خود را از طریق سفر برنامه نویسی خود مستند کند. و سلام و خوش آمدید و کارفرمایان این مطلب را در آینده می خوانند!

حالا باید صادقانه بگویم، این در واقع “اولین روز” من نیست. من در واقع دو روز پیش از دوشنبه شروع کردم. اما من معتقدم که امروز کاملاً روزی بود که من واقعاً روی چیزهایی که یاد می‌گیرم سرمایه‌گذاری کردم.

صحبت از، اجازه دهید به آنچه که امروز آموختم! من در مورد همه چیز صحبت نمی کنم، فقط چیزهایی که من را بیشتر مجذوب کرده است.

شنوندگان رویداد

من رسماً با هیجان انگیزترین ویژگی جاوا اسکریپت آشنا شدم… شنوندگان رویداد. زبان اصلی من که قبل از این یاد می‌گرفتم C# بود که شباهت‌هایی با هم دارد، اما واقعاً به من کمک کرد تا مفهوم را بهتر درک کنم. بیایید دو مثال بزنم تا بتوانم منظورم را با یک keydown ساده برای جاوا و سی شارپ توضیح دهم.

جاوا اسکریپت

addEventListener(“keydown”, (event) => {});

onkeydown = (event) => {};

سی شارپ

void Update()
{
if (Input.GetKeyDown(“space”))
{
Debug.Log(“space key was pressed”);
}
}

حالا با نگاه کردن به هر دوی آنها می توانم شروع به دیدن تفاوت بین آنها کنم. مانند اینکه چگونه C# برای جستجوی دستورات به یک به روز رسانی دائمی نیاز دارد در حالی که جاوا این کار را نمی کند، بسیار جالب است.

تمرین محل کار

یکی از کارهای کوچک‌تری که امروز از انجام آن لذت می‌بردم، تمرین نحوه انجام کار در فضای کاری بود. داشتم یک وب سایت با دکمه فرم و ارسال می دادم. و در اصل به من گفته شد …

به عنوان یک کاربر، باید بتوانم یک کار را در قسمت ورودی تایپ کنم.
به عنوان یک کاربر، باید بتوانم روی برخی از شکل های دکمه ارسال کلیک کنم.
به عنوان یک کاربر، من انتظار دارم که بعد از فعال شدن دکمه ارسال، رشته وظیفه ای که ارائه کردم در DOM ظاهر شود.

و من باید با مهارت هایی که قبلا یاد گرفتم تطبیق می دادم و درخواست های پایان نامه را می دادم. بسیار هیجان انگیز!

اما این چیزی است که من احساس می‌کردم برای سفر یادگیری من منحصر به فرد است. از افراد Flatiron برای فرصت عالی متشکریم. فردا میبینمتون👋

سلام، فیش اینجاست،

این اولین پست وبلاگ من خواهد بود! من این کار را به درخواست مربی شگفت انگیزم در مدرسه Flatiron انجام می دهم. من سعی خواهم کرد هر روز یک پست وبلاگ ایجاد کنم که توسعه خود را از طریق سفر برنامه نویسی خود مستند کند. و سلام و خوش آمدید و کارفرمایان این مطلب را در آینده می خوانند!

حالا باید صادقانه بگویم، این در واقع “اولین روز” من نیست. من در واقع دو روز پیش از دوشنبه شروع کردم. اما من معتقدم که امروز کاملاً روزی بود که من واقعاً روی چیزهایی که یاد می‌گیرم سرمایه‌گذاری کردم.

صحبت از، اجازه دهید به آنچه که امروز آموختم! من در مورد همه چیز صحبت نمی کنم، فقط چیزهایی که من را بیشتر مجذوب کرده است.

شنوندگان رویداد

من رسماً با هیجان انگیزترین ویژگی جاوا اسکریپت آشنا شدم… شنوندگان رویداد. زبان اصلی من که قبل از این یاد می‌گرفتم C# بود که شباهت‌هایی با هم دارد، اما واقعاً به من کمک کرد تا مفهوم را بهتر درک کنم. بیایید دو مثال بزنم تا بتوانم منظورم را با یک keydown ساده برای جاوا و سی شارپ توضیح دهم.

جاوا اسکریپت

addEventListener("keydown", (event) => {});

onkeydown = (event) => {};

سی شارپ

void Update()
    {
        if (Input.GetKeyDown("space"))
        {
            Debug.Log("space key was pressed");
        }
    }

حالا با نگاه کردن به هر دوی آنها می توانم شروع به دیدن تفاوت بین آنها کنم. مانند اینکه چگونه C# برای جستجوی دستورات به یک به روز رسانی دائمی نیاز دارد در حالی که جاوا این کار را نمی کند، بسیار جالب است.

تمرین محل کار

یکی از کارهای کوچک‌تری که امروز از انجام آن لذت می‌بردم، تمرین نحوه انجام کار در فضای کاری بود. داشتم یک وب سایت با دکمه فرم و ارسال می دادم. و در اصل به من گفته شد …

به عنوان یک کاربر، باید بتوانم یک کار را در قسمت ورودی تایپ کنم.
به عنوان یک کاربر، باید بتوانم روی برخی از شکل های دکمه ارسال کلیک کنم.
به عنوان یک کاربر، من انتظار دارم که بعد از فعال شدن دکمه ارسال، رشته وظیفه ای که ارائه کردم در DOM ظاهر شود.

و من باید با مهارت هایی که قبلا یاد گرفتم تطبیق می دادم و درخواست های پایان نامه را می دادم. بسیار هیجان انگیز!

اما این چیزی است که من احساس می‌کردم برای سفر یادگیری من منحصر به فرد است. از افراد Flatiron برای فرصت عالی متشکریم. فردا میبینمتون👋

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ا